I-CuNi40(6J40) I-Alloy yeCopper Nickel Constantan Wire

Inkcazo emfutshane:

I-Copper Nickel Alloy yenziwe kakhulu nge-copper kunye ne-nickel. I-copper kunye ne-nickel zinokunyibilikiswa kunye nokuba ipesenti engakanani na. Ngokwesiqhelo i-resistivity ye-CuNi alloy iya kuba phezulu ukuba umxholo we-Nickel mkhulu kunomxholo we-Copper. Ukusuka kwi-CuNi1 ukuya kwi-CuNi44, i-resistivity isuka kwi-0.03μΩm ukuya kwi-0.49μΩm.     I-CuNi40(6J40)
    uConstantanyiCuNi40, ekwabizwa ngokuba yi-6J40, yi-resistance alloy eyenziwe kakhulu nge-copper kunye ne-nickel.
    Inomlinganiselo wobushushu ophantsi wokuxhathisa, ububanzi bobushushu bokusebenza (500 ngezantsi), ipropathi elungileyo yomatshini, ayibolisi kwaye kulula ukuwelda ngebraze.

    I-alloy ayinamagnethi. Isetyenziselwa i-resistor eguquguqukayo ye-regenerator yombane kunye ne-resistor yoxinzelelo,
    ii-potentiometers, iingcingo zokufudumeza, iintambo zokufudumeza kunye neemathi. Iiribhoni zisetyenziselwa ukufudumeza ii-bimetals. Enye indawo esetyenziswayo kukuvelisa ii-thermocouples kuba iphuhlisa amandla aphezulu e-electromotive (EMF) xa idityaniswa nezinye iintsimbi.

    Uthotho lwe-alloy ye-nickel yobhedu: uConstantan CuNi40 (6J40), uCuNi1, uCuNi2, uCuNi6, uCuNi8, uCuNi10, uCuNi14, uCuNi19, uCuNi23, uCuNi30, uCuNi34, uCuNi44.

    Iiklasi eziphambili kunye neepropathi

    Uhlobo Ukumelana nombane
    (20degreeΩ
    mm²/m)
    umlinganiselo wobushushu bokumelana
    (10^6/degree)
    IiDens
    i-ity
    g/mm²
    Ubushushu obuphezulu
    (°c)
    Indawo yokunyibilika
    (°c)
    I-CuNi1 0.03 <1000 8.9 / 1085
    I-CuNi2 0.05 <1200 8.9 200 1090
    I-CuNi6 0.10 <600 8.9 220 1095
    I-CuNi8 0.12 <570 8.9 250 1097
    I-CuNi10 0.15 <500 8.9 250 1100
    I-CuNi14 0.20 <380 8.9 300 1115
    I-CuNi19 0.25 <250 8.9 300 1135
    I-CuNi23 0.30 <160 8.9 300 1150
    I-CuNi30 0.35 <100 8.9 350 1170
    I-CuNi34 0.40 -0 8.9 350 1180
    I-CuNi40 0.48 ±40 8.9 400 1280
    I-CuNi44 0.49 <-6 8.9 400 1280
